Delhi AQI 381 'Very Poor'; Flights Face Disruptions Amid Fog
- •Delhi's AQI was 381 ('very poor') on Tuesday morning, despite emergency curbs under GRAP-4.
- •The city's air quality showed a marginal improvement from 'severe' to 'very poor' compared to previous days.
- •Wazirpur (434 AQI) and Jahangirpuri (430 AQI) were among the most polluted areas, remaining in the 'severe' category.
- •Dense fog and poor visibility caused flight disruptions at Delhi airport, with Air India cancelling flights and IndiGo issuing advisories.
Why It Matters: Delhi's toxic air and fog impact health and disrupt travel.
